Credit Union Australia Ltd (CUA)

Comments on Credit Union Australia Ltd (CUA). Shop 1092, Carindale Shopping Centre, Creek Rd, Carindale 4152 QLD
Please share as much information as you can about Credit Union Australia Ltd (CUA) so other users can benefit from your comment.
Can't read?